Tyler, the Creator Is Releasing a 'Grinch'-Themed EP Tomorrow

Hear a track with Santigold and Ryan Beatty now

BY Calum SlingerlandPublished Nov 15, 2018

Already in the seasonal spirit with a pair of contributions to The Grinch soundtrack, Tyler, the Creator has now revealed that he has another gift in store for listeners with the announcement of a new EP.

Tomorrow (November 16), Tyler will release a six-track EP titled Music Inspired by Illumination & Dr. Seuss' The Grinch. While it doesn't include either of his contributions to the film's soundtrack, it boasts features from Santigold, Ryan Beatty and Jerry Paper.

Music Inspired by Illumination & Dr. Seuss' The Grinch:

1. Whoville
2. Lights On (feat. Santigold and Ryan Beatty)
3. Hot Chocolate (feat. Jerry Paper)
4. Big Bag
5. When Gloves Come Off (feat. Ryan Beatty)
6. Cindy Lou's Wish
